France is under a heatwave alert, according to a report by France 24 — English. The alert comes as the country experiences punishing temperatures, prompting residents to seek relief in creative ways. Photographs accompanying the report show a worker in western France drinking water to refresh himself on May 26, 2026, and two adolescents jumping into the Saint Martin canal in Paris on the same day to cool off.
